Calculate Your Total Monthly Income

The first step in How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income is determining your total monthly earnings. Include all sources of income such as:

  • Salary or wages
  • Freelance earnings
  • Business income
  • Rental income
  • Side hustles
  • Investment income

If your income fluctuates monthly, use the average amount earned over the last six months. The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) recommends keeping accurate records of all income sources for effective financial planning and tax reporting.

List All Monthly Expenses

A key part of How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income is identifying your expenses. Divide them into fixed and variable categories.

Fixed Expenses

  • Rent or mortgage
  • Insurance
  • Loan payments
  • Internet and subscriptions

Variable Expenses

  • Food and groceries
  • Transportation
  • Entertainment
  • Shopping
  • Utilities

Tracking expenses helps you identify unnecessary spending and create opportunities to save more money. Understanding How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income means knowing exactly where every dollar goes.

Use the 50/30/20 Budget Rule

Many financial experts recommend the 50/30/20 rule when learning How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income.

  • 50% for necessities
  • 30% for wants
  • 20% for savings and debt repayment

This budgeting method provides a simple framework for managing money without becoming overly restrictive. Resources from Investopedia offer additional insights into implementing this popular budgeting strategy.

Prioritize Savings First

An important principle of How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income is paying yourself first. Before spending on non-essential items, set aside money for:

  • Emergency funds
  • Retirement savings
  • Investments
  • Major future purchases

Financial experts generally recommend building an emergency fund that can cover three to six months of living expenses. Consistent saving is one of the fastest ways to improve long-term financial stability.

Monitor and Adjust Your Budget

Creating a budget is not a one-time task. To truly master How to Create a Monthly Budget with Income, review your budget regularly. Track spending weekly and compare it to your budget goals.

If you notice overspending in certain categories, make adjustments for the following month. Budgeting tools offered by organizations such as Federal Reserve Bank of St. Louis – Econ Lowdown can help improve financial literacy and money management skills.
